This guide will walk you through the steps to setup Kustomer as a new channel with Chatdesk Teams.

1. From your Kustomer dashboard, please Visit Settings > Security > API Keys

2. Create a new API Key with the following settings

Name - Chatdesk
Expires - No Expiration
Roles - org.user            
            org.hooks            
            org.tracking                        
            org.admin

3. Copy the new API Key

4. In a separate tab, please open your Chatdesk Teams dashboard. From here, please visit Settings > Channels > Kustomer > Add Kustomer Account

Enter the subdomain for your Kustomer account http://YourSubdomain.kustomerapp.com

5. Paste the API Key from Kustomer

6. Copy the Webhook URL

7. Go back to your Kustomer dashboard. From here, visit Settings > Platform > Workflows > Create New Workflow

Workflow Title - Email workflow for Chatdesk

8. Add the URL copied from Teams here

9. Copy "/#steps.1" into the box highlighted below

10. Save and toggle on the workflow

11. Go back to your Kustomer dashboard. Then, please visit Settings > Platform Settings > Workflows > Create New Workflow.

Workflow Title - Chat workflow for Chatdesk

12. Add the URL copied from Teams here

13. Copy "/#steps.1" into the box highlighted below

Outbound Webhook

14. Go to Settings > Platform > Outbound webhooks

15. Create new outbound webhook with the url https://teamsapi.chatdesk.com/api/kustomer/closedTicketWebHook

Your Kustomer account is now linked with Chatdesk Teams!
